Conversion Formula for Centimeter to Femtometer
The formula of conversion of Centimeter to Femtometer is very simple. To convert Centimeter to Femtometer, we can use this simple formula:
1 Centimeter = 10,000,000,000,000 Femtometer
1 Femtometer = 0 Centimeter
One Centimeter is equal to 10,000,000,000,000 Femtometer. So, we need to multiply the number of Centimeter by 10,000,000,000,000 to get the no of Femtometer. This formula helps when we need to change the measurements from Centimeter to Femtometer

Details for Centimeter (Everyday Metric Unit)
Introduction : The centimeter, equal to 1/100 of a meter, is a convenient unit for human-scale measurements. It bridges the gap between meters and millimeters for clothing, furniture, and personal height measurements.
History & Origin : Developed as part of the original metric system in 1790s France. The prefix 'centi-' comes from Latin for hundred. Gained widespread adoption through education systems and tailoring industries.
Current Use : Common for body measurements (height, waist size), furniture dimensions, and school rulers. Used in meteorology for rainfall, medicine for tumor sizes, and clothing patterns worldwide.
Details for Femtometer (Nuclear Scale)
Introduction : The femtometer (also called a fermi) equals one quadrillionth of a meter, used to measure nuclear dimensions and subatomic particles. This scale reveals the incredibly tiny world within atomic nuclei, where quantum forces dominate.
History & Origin : Originally named 'fermi' after physicist Enrico Fermi. Became standard in nuclear physics during the 1950s. The SI name 'femtometer' was adopted later, though many nuclear physicists still use 'fermi' colloquially.
Current Use : Measures proton diameter (≈1.7 fm), nuclear reaction cross-sections, and quark interactions. Used in particle accelerator experiments and quantum chromodynamics. The strong nuclear force operates at about 1-3 femtometer ranges.
